Ticket #—Cleaning Crew Access, Brightleaf Annex

Hey facilities folks — the Sparrowdale cleaning crew starts their new rotation Monday night, 22:00–02:00, covering floors 2 and 3. Their old fobs were deactivated last week, so they'll need the side-door keypad instead. Please log their entry times as usual. Here's the code they should use.

door code, kahap-yadup: bdg-S-90

Subject: Quickstore 4.2 — bloom filter now fronts the KV layer

Plugin authors: starting with this release, Quickstore places a bloom filter ahead of the key-value store. Negative lookups return faster; false positives fall through safely. No API changes are required on your side. Verify your plugin against the staging build referenced below.

session token of fahif-tadup = htk3_9c7

**Q: Can I get into the basement archive room?**

Yes — but not with your standard badge, sorry! The Corbett Archive under Maplewick House holds original contracts and old project files, so access is a bit stricter. Book a slot with the records team first, sign the ledger by the door, and never leave files overnight on the reading table. Once your slot's confirmed, open the door using the code below.

door code, kawip-bagap: bdg-HQEWH-4